What Families Should Consider Before Relocating

Before making the move, families should evaluate:

  • School options and commute times

  • Healthcare access

  • Internet reliability

  • Daily services and shopping

  • Seasonal activity differences

Planning ahead ensures expectations match reality.

Buyer Tip: Visit Like a Local

Before committing, families should:

  • Spend a full week at the lake

  • Experience weekday routines

  • Visit schools and neighborhoods

  • Test internet and cell service

  • Explore year-round amenities

This helps confirm long-term fit.
